NEW LEGISLATION INTRODUCED TO REPEAL AB962!
Immediately following Governor Schwarzenegger's signing of the Ammunition Sales Registration Bill, AB962, NRA announced our effort to repeal this misguided and un-necessary legislation by amending NRA sponsored AB373 into a "Repeal bill."
This effort has been welcomed by overwhelming support throughout the firearms community within the state and the California Rifle and Pistol Association immediately added their total support to this effort. Gun stores, ranges, hunting & shooting clubs, collectors, hunters, and those who value our freedoms, have all joined this effort to repeal AB962.
Because of this overwhelming support from firearms owners throughout the state, it has been decided to use a different legislative vehicle in the effort to Repeal AB962. The reason is because the time for AB373 to be heard in the legislative committee was nearing the end and many people still had not had a chance to sign the "Letter of Support of the Repeal of AB962" yet. Assemblyman Hagman has introduced AB1663, which does not require a hearing until later this year. This gives everyone a chance to sign the "Letter."
